EasyPhp : Erreur Mysql

Gollum -  
Reivax962 Messages postés 3672 Date d'inscription   Statut Membre Dernière intervention   -
Bonjour à tous.

Je suis en train de développer un site web avec easyPhp. Bien sur, j'ai une base de données MySql (sinon c'est pas drole...). Aprés une requête je l'éxécute etje réalise le testen cas d'erreur comme ceci :

mysql_query($sql) or die(mysql_error())

Tout le reste du code passe, cependant, une erreur me revient :

FUNCTION [nom de la base].mysql_error does not exist

Voila. Si l'un d'entre vous à une idée, je lui serai trés reconnaissant de me conseiller sur la démarche à suivre pour me débarasser de cette maudite erreur.

Je vous remercie d'avance pour votre aide.
A voir également:

2 réponses

Reivax962 Messages postés 3672 Date d'inscription   Statut Membre Dernière intervention   1 011
 
Bonjour,

Quelle version de MySQL utilises-tu ?

Xavier
0
gollumeries Messages postés 13 Date d'inscription   Statut Membre Dernière intervention  
 
La version c est 4.1.9
Voici le nouveaau code aprés qq modifications.
J arrive bien à afficher la première ligne, mais pas les suivantes...

<?

$nblignes = mysql_num_rows($resultat);
$nbchamps = mysql_num_fields($resultat);
$nbl = 0;
$nbc = 0;

while($dat = mysql_fetch_array($resultat)) {
while ($nbl < $nblignes) {

echo '<tr>';

while ($nbc < $nbchamps) {

echo'<td>'.$dat[mysql_field_name($resultat, $nbc)].'</td>';
$nbc++;
$nbl++;
}
$nbc++;
$nbl++;

echo '</tr>';
}
}

?>
0
Reivax962 Messages postés 3672 Date d'inscription   Statut Membre Dernière intervention   1 011
 
Bonjour,

Essaie de corriger ton code comme ceci :
<?

$nblignes = mysql_num_rows($resultat);
$nbchamps = mysql_num_fields($resultat);
$nbl = 0;
$nbc = 0;

while($dat = mysql_fetch_array($resultat)) {
while ($nbl < $nblignes) {

echo '<tr>';

while ($nbc < $nbchamps) {

echo'<td>'.$dat[mysql_field_name($resultat, $nbc)].'</td>';
$nbc++;
}
$nbc = 0;
$nbl++;

echo '</tr>';
}
}

?>
0
Reivax962 Messages postés 3672 Date d'inscription   Statut Membre Dernière intervention   1 011
 
Sinon, tu as pu résoudre ton problème de mysql_error() ?
0